I'm wondering what to do about the inside top edge of the doors:

139866

I know there is info on the forum, but I am too lazy to search.
I did read that some grind it down flush; but won't that open the seam?
I read that some fill over the seam with Rage Gold (using a split piece of hose to apply).
What is best?

Smooth the tops out with your D/A or tackle the task by hand (60-80 Grit) and float it over with the Evercoat Rage Gold.
You can also use Evercoat Fibertech if you want a structural filler and then smooth it out with the Rage Gold filler as your top for the final coat.
Also, pay a good bit of attention to where the doors meet the cowl because if you clean those areas up, it makes the car look a lot more finished.
